Why Tech Careers Are the Future

Technology is the backbone of almost every industry today. From healthcare to finance, education to entertainment, digital transformation is reshaping how businesses operate. According to the U.S. Bureau of Labor Statistics, employment in computer and information technology occupations is projected to grow 15% from 2021 to 2031, much faster than the average for all occupations.

The key drivers for this growth include:

  • Automation: Businesses are automating processes using AI and robotics.
  • Data Explosion: Organizations are generating massive amounts of data, driving demand for data analysts and engineers.
  • Cybersecurity Threats: As cyberattacks increase, the need for skilled security professionals grows.
  • Emerging Technologies: Blockchain, quantum computing, and the Internet of Things (IoT) are opening new career paths.

By understanding these trends, you can choose a career that not only offers stability but also high earning potential and personal growth.


1. Artificial Intelligence (AI) and Machine Learning Engineer

Why It’s in Demand: AI and machine learning are no longer futuristic concepts—they are integrated into daily business operations, from chatbots and recommendation engines to predictive analytics. Companies in healthcare, finance, retail, and autonomous vehicles are increasingly relying on AI solutions.

Key Skills Required:

  • Python, R, and Java programming
  • Deep learning frameworks like TensorFlow and PyTorch
  • Natural language processing (NLP)
  • Data analysis and visualization

Salary and Growth: AI engineers have a median salary of $120,000–$150,000 per year, with experienced specialists earning significantly more. The demand is expected to grow 22% over the next decade, making it one of the most lucrative tech careers.


2. Cybersecurity Specialist

Why It’s in Demand: With cybercrime escalating globally, companies are investing heavily in cybersecurity. Protecting sensitive data and preventing breaches has become a critical priority.

Key Skills Required:

  • Network security and firewalls
  • Ethical hacking and penetration testing
  • Cloud security and compliance
  • Incident response management

Salary and Growth: Cybersecurity professionals earn between $90,000–$130,000 annually, and advanced roles like Chief Information Security Officer (CISO) can exceed $200,000. The field is projected to grow 33% by 2031, making it one of the fastest-growing tech careers.


3. Data Scientist and Data Analyst

Why It’s in Demand: Every organization wants to make data-driven decisions. Data scientists analyze complex datasets to uncover patterns, while data analysts focus on reporting insights. Both roles are essential in sectors like healthcare, finance, e-commerce, and marketing.

Key Skills Required:

  • SQL, Python, and R for data analysis
  • Machine learning algorithms
  • Data visualization tools like Tableau and Power BI
  • Statistical analysis and modeling

Salary and Growth: Data scientists earn $95,000–$140,000 annually, with top professionals in tech hubs earning over $180,000. Demand for data experts is expected to increase by 36% by 2031.


4. Cloud Computing Engineer

Why It’s in Demand: Cloud technology has transformed the way businesses operate, providing scalable infrastructure, reducing costs, and enabling remote work. Roles in cloud computing focus on designing, deploying, and managing cloud environments.

Key Skills Required:

  • Cloud platforms: AWS, Azure, Google Cloud
  • Virtualization and containerization (Docker, Kubernetes)
  • DevOps practices
  • Cloud security

Salary and Growth: Cloud engineers earn $110,000–$145,000 per year, with experienced cloud architects earning over $160,000. The sector is projected to grow by 20–25% over the next decade.


5. Blockchain Developer

Why It’s in Demand: Blockchain technology underpins cryptocurrencies, supply chain management, and decentralized finance (DeFi). As companies explore secure and transparent transactions, blockchain developers are in high demand.

Key Skills Required:

  • Solidity, JavaScript, and Python
  • Smart contract development
  • Cryptography and distributed ledger technology
  • Decentralized application (DApp) design

Salary and Growth: Blockchain developers earn $100,000–$150,000 annually, with senior roles exceeding $180,000. Blockchain adoption is expected to accelerate, particularly in finance and logistics.


6. DevOps Engineer

Why It’s in Demand: DevOps bridges development and IT operations, improving software deployment speed, reliability, and scalability. Companies pursuing agile methodologies need skilled DevOps professionals.

Key Skills Required:

  • CI/CD pipelines
  • Cloud platforms and automation tools
  • Scripting languages: Python, Bash, or Go
  • Monitoring and performance optimization

Salary and Growth: DevOps engineers earn $100,000–$140,000 annually, with senior roles reaching $160,000. Demand is projected to grow 21% over the next decade.


7. Robotics Engineer

Why It’s in Demand: Robotics is revolutionizing manufacturing, healthcare, agriculture, and even home automation. Engineers design, build, and maintain robots, integrating AI for smarter functionality.

Key Skills Required:

  • Robotics programming languages like C++ and Python
  • Knowledge of sensors and actuators
  • Embedded systems and AI integration
  • Mechanical design and control systems

Salary and Growth: Robotics engineers earn $85,000–$130,000 annually, with specialized roles in autonomous vehicles or medical robotics exceeding $150,000. Robotics careers are projected to grow 15–20% in the next decade.


8. Internet of Things (IoT) Specialist

Why It’s in Demand: IoT devices are everywhere—from smart homes to industrial sensors. IoT specialists develop solutions that connect devices, collect data, and optimize processes.

Key Skills Required:

  • IoT protocols and communication standards
  • Embedded programming (C/C++, Python)
  • Cloud integration and analytics
  • Security for IoT networks

Salary and Growth: IoT specialists earn $90,000–$130,000 annually, and the market is projected to grow rapidly with connected devices, making this a high-potential career.


9. Virtual Reality (VR) and Augmented Reality (AR) Developer

Why It’s in Demand: VR and AR are transforming gaming, education, healthcare, and retail. Developers create immersive experiences, from virtual training programs to interactive shopping platforms.

Key Skills Required:

  • Unity or Unreal Engine
  • 3D modeling and animation
  • C#, C++, and Python programming
  • UX/UI design for immersive experiences

Salary and Growth: VR/AR developers earn $80,000–$120,000 annually, with specialized roles in enterprise or gaming exceeding $150,000. The sector is expected to grow 30–35% over the next decade.


10. Quantum Computing Researcher

Why It’s in Demand: Quantum computing promises to solve problems beyond the capabilities of classical computers. While still emerging, this field offers groundbreaking opportunities in cryptography, drug discovery, and complex simulations.

Key Skills Required:

  • Quantum algorithms and programming (Qiskit, Cirq)
  • Linear algebra and advanced mathematics
  • Physics of quantum systems
  • Research and problem-solving skills

Salary and Growth: Entry-level quantum researchers earn $90,000–$120,000, while experienced professionals can exceed $200,000. With increasing investment from tech giants, quantum computing careers will continue expanding.


How to Prepare for a Tech Career in the Next 10 Years

  1. Continuous Learning: Tech evolves rapidly. Online courses, certifications, and workshops are essential.
  2. Hands-On Experience: Build projects, participate in hackathons, and contribute to open-source initiatives.
  3. Networking: Join tech communities, attend conferences, and connect with industry professionals.
  4. Soft Skills Matter: Communication, teamwork, and problem-solving are equally crucial.
  5. Certifications Boost Careers: AWS, Google Cloud, CompTIA Security+, and machine learning certifications enhance credibility.
